Mayor Zohran Mamdani’s budget reality is taking shape: Albany is delaying NYC’s class-size mandate, the NYPD is hiring above flat-headcount promises, City Hall is probing charter reform, and Metro-North is moving toward a long-overdue fleet replacement.
